Battery

The battery inside the key fob of your car is a frequent cause of failure. It is recommended to always have an extra battery at home or in the car. The process of changing a fob is relatively simple but it varies between car manufacturers and manufacturer. Refer to the owner's guide for more details.

Typically, you'll need either a CR2025, or CR2032, 3-Volt battery. You can find these batteries at a variety of electronics stores, or even at your local auto parts shop. You will need a screwdriver to take out the old battery and open the fob. Make sure you work on an even, clean surface with ample lighting to ensure that you don't loose any small parts.

As the battery on the fob gets depleted the signal to your car will diminish. This reduces the range of the fob, and could require you to be closer to your vehicle to unlock it or start it. The battery will eventually fail and you'll have to replace it.

The key fob is divided in two sections: the front key section, and the transmitter portion that houses the battery. To access the transmitter section, fold back the skoda key fob replacement fob and then use a screwdriver for the separation of the two sections. Lift the cover to the direction of the arrow using the screwdriver and then remove the batteries from the previous one. Insert the new battery and make sure that the + symbol is facing downwards. Replace the cover by pressing the two sections together.

Transponder Chip

The transponder chip on the key fob communicates with your vehicle's ECU to disarm the standard immobilizer to allow the car to start. This method isn't foolproof. Criminals have found ways to get around this technology. If you own a car equipped with transponder technology recommend that you keep an extra spare and have it made by a locksmith.

To change the batteries in a skoda key fob you must first remove the housing of the key fob so that you can access the circuit board. This is done with the small "key" built into the seam of the unit to pry the housing open. Be cautious to not damage the key fob's housing. The key fob runs on the CR2032 disc type of battery. Battery life can range between two and four years depending on the usage.

The battery from the old one can be removed and replaced with a fresh one. Make sure you insert the new battery correctly. On the inside of the cover of the key fob tiny guides show the correct orientation. The key blade can also be replaced at this point. You can either buy an additional key blade at a parts store or have an expert locksmith cut it for you.
